Expanding Economic Opportunities through Microfinance Global Communities is helping to expand economic opportunities in Ghana through Boafo Microfinance Services Ltd. Established in 2007, Boafo is a microfinance service company created through a partnership between HFC Bank Limited (Ghana) and Global Communities with funding support from USAID and the United Nations.

The World Health Organization (WHO) has changed its advice on face masks, saying they should be worn in public to help stop the spread of coronavirus. The global body said new information showed they could provide "a barrier for potentially infectious droplets".

The World Health Organization is the United Nations specialized agency for health. It was established on 7 April 1948. WHO''s objective is the attainment by all peoples of the highest possible level of health.
